Two historic bridges are located in the Lenora vicinity. They are both listed on the National Register of Historic Places. The North Fork Solomon River Lattice Truss Bridge located on Road W, 0.l mile south of the intersection with Road BB, 1.5 miles west of Lenora, KS.
